Small, sturdy, shareable: Tenways CGO Compact rethinks the city bike

Verge reviews the Tenways CGO Compact, a €1,999 (about $2,365) compact city e-bike designed for sharing. It quickly fits riders 160–190 cm with tool-free height and handlebar adjustments, folds to a slim 20-inch-wheeled profile, and supports up to 27 kg on the rear rack. Powered by a 250W rear-hub motor with 45 Nm of torque, its 494.36Wh battery delivers about 65 km of range and charges in 4.5 hours. It includes integrated lights, mudguards, a PIN-protected LCD, and a largely optional app. The ride is comfortable and capable on hills for its size, making it a strong, adaptable option for European cities—though quick-release parts raise theft concerns and the app offers little beyond basic data.

Tenways CGO600 Pro e-bike: A Silent and Svelte Review

Dutch e-bike manufacturer Tenways has launched its lightweight CGO600 Pro in the US market. The $1,899 single-speed e-bike weighs 37 lbs and has a 360 W rear hub motor powered by a 36 V, 10 Ah Li-ion battery, which provides up to 53 miles of range. The CGO600 Pro uses a carbon belt-drive system instead of a chain, which reduces maintenance and noise. The bike's LCD display is small and mounted near the handgrip on the left side of the handlebar. The bike is easy to assemble, but the front wheel mounting can be tricky.
